School’s in at Lowe Wines

Media release: August 2010

One of Mudgee’s leading winemakers, Lowe Wines, will be hosting a series of Wine Schools as part of the upcoming Mudgee Wine & Food Festival in September.

David Lowe, winemaker and owner of Lowe Wines, will host the Wine Schools, which are a key feature of Mudgee’s annual festival.  There will be two series comprising a number of one-hour ‘introduction to wine’ sessions, as well as more intensive, four-hour sessions.

David Lowe | Lowe Wines

David Lowe has great passion for wine education and is keen to offer Mudgee visitors a chance to get more involved with wine.  “It’s what we do at the cellar door. We teach visitors about the flavours and characteristics of wine and the terroir of Mudgee,” said Lowe.  “There is a real interest in what we do as winemakers, so we have decided to host a few informative, yet informal wine schools.”

The Lowe Wine Schools will run during the Mudgee Wine & Food Festival in September.

DAVID LOWE’S WINE SCHOOL: 
4 hour Session, 4-8pm, Lowe winery, Tinja Lane Mudgee

Cost: $60.00 per person.

A practical, hands on tasting tutorial, led by one of Australia’s most respected winemakers, David Lowe, including:

  • the fundamentals of colour, aroma and taste, so that guests can learn to pace themselves and avoid palate fatigue;
  • the terms used in wine tasting and examples of faulty wines;
  • a tutorial based around tasting three varietal white wines, including Pinot Gris, Sauvignon Blanc and Chardonnay;
  • synergies of wine and food matching using a tasting plate of terrine, olives, bread and olive oil;
  • a structured red wine tutorial focusing on  Cabernet Sauvignon, Pinot Noir and Shiraz;
  • a vertical Riesling bracket - a tutorial on bottle age, showcasing Riesling’s transformation from youth to complexity;
  • a vertical Shiraz bracket – learn what happens when red wines age, and express it in your own terms; and
  • utilising your recently learnt skills to expressing your own feelings about a flight of four very different wines.

DAVID LOWE’S MINI WINE SCHOOL
1 Hour Session, 5-6pm, Lowe Winery, Tinja Lane, Mudgee

Cost: FREE, bookings appreciated.

The Mini Wine School will comprise a tasting conducted by winemaker David Lowe and include an explanation of how to taste wine and get the most from your own palate.  There will be three white wines of the same variety and three red wines of the same variety tasted.  The focus will be identifying stylistic differences with each variety.

Lowe Wine was established in Mudgee in 1987 by David Lowe and now comprises the Lowe, Louee and Tinja brands. The winery and vineyards gained organic accreditation 2004.  David Lowe is a high profile proponent of NSW regional wines and a key advocate in re-establishing NSW wines as the wines of choice with consumers in Australia.  David is also a leading advocate of organic winemaking, sustainable farming and regionalism, with a focus on the Mudgee and the Central Ranges.

David Lowe is the President of NSW Wines as well as Vice President of Winemakers Federation of Australia.
